About the role
In this role you’ll have the opportunity to make a real difference to the Royal Navy Training Design Service. As the Senior Media Developer, you’ll support the business in delivering learning that is blended, active and provides customer delight.

Responsibilities
- Produce interactive media for our customer’s training courses in accordance with Courseware / Media production process, Development Manual and Style Guide.
- Interactive media to be developed in Unity using 3D assets provided by 3D developers.
- You will be responsible for building the interactive functionality as part of our training delivery resource.
- To produce interactive media in accordance with best practice in areas of Graphic Design, Multi-Media.
- Creation of media / animation sequences / eLearning / virtual environments exploiting effective asset management and workflow.
- Visualising and planning of media along a timeline.
